1
This commit is contained in:
@@ -33,6 +33,24 @@
|
||||
)
|
||||
</insert>
|
||||
|
||||
<update id="updateGroupRebateExcelUpload" parameterType="GroupRebateExcelUpload">
|
||||
update jd_group_rebate_excel_upload
|
||||
set document_title = #{documentTitle},
|
||||
original_filename = #{originalFilename},
|
||||
file_path = #{filePath},
|
||||
file_size = #{fileSize},
|
||||
import_status = #{importStatus},
|
||||
data_rows = #{dataRows},
|
||||
updated_orders = #{updatedOrders},
|
||||
not_found_count = #{notFoundCount},
|
||||
result_detail_json = #{resultDetailJson}
|
||||
where id = #{id}
|
||||
</update>
|
||||
|
||||
<delete id="deleteGroupRebateExcelUploadById" parameterType="long">
|
||||
delete from jd_group_rebate_excel_upload where id = #{id}
|
||||
</delete>
|
||||
|
||||
<select id="selectGroupRebateExcelUploadById" parameterType="long" resultMap="GroupRebateExcelUploadResult">
|
||||
<include refid="selectCols"/>
|
||||
where id = #{id}
|
||||
|
||||
@@ -233,6 +233,16 @@
|
||||
limit 1
|
||||
</select>
|
||||
|
||||
<select id="selectOrderIdsByRebateRemarkUploadRecordId" parameterType="long" resultType="long">
|
||||
select id from jd_order
|
||||
where rebate_remark_json is not null
|
||||
and char_length(trim(rebate_remark_json)) > 2
|
||||
and (
|
||||
rebate_remark_json like concat('%"uploadRecordId":', #{uploadRecordId}, ',%')
|
||||
or rebate_remark_json like concat('%"uploadRecordId":', #{uploadRecordId}, '}%')
|
||||
)
|
||||
</select>
|
||||
|
||||
<delete id="deleteJDOrderByIds" parameterType="long">
|
||||
delete from jd_order where id in
|
||||
<foreach collection="array" item="id" open="(" separator="," close=")">
|
||||
|
||||
Reference in New Issue
Block a user